About Our School:

William de Ferrers School is based in the centre of South Woodham Ferrers, a riverside town on the north bank of the River Crouch. The school is approximately 14 miles from the city of Chelmsford, with good rail links to London Liverpool Street. 

The school is housed in a purpose built community complex which is unique in Essex, benefiting from excellent accommodation and extensive grounds. 

The school was rated 'good'  by Ofsted in December 2018.

William de Ferrers currently has a seven form entry with the main pastoral organisation based on a year system. Great importance is attached to high standards of conduct, dress, attitude and work. A large percentage of students stay on to join the sixth form and year 12 and 13 students are an integral part of the whole school, they make a valuable contribution to the life of the school supporting younger students across a wide range of activities.
